#4b3e28 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#4b3e28 is composed of 29.4% red, 24.3% green and 15.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 17.3% magenta, 46.7% yellow and 70.6% black. It has a hue angle of 37.7 degrees, a saturation of 30.4% and a lightness of 22.5%. #4b3e28 color hex could be obtained by blending #967c50 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#333333.

● #4b3e28 color description : Very dark desaturated orange.
#4b3e28 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#4b3e28 has RGB values of R:75, G:62, B:40 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.17, Y:0.47, K:0.71. Its decimal value is 4931112.
